ARM和嵌入式解释,是ARM开发嵌入式开发ARM嵌入式系统开发

发布于 科技 2024-05-02
12个回答
  1. 匿名用户2024-01-28

    ARM既是一家公司,也是一个芯片名称和结构。

    一般我们所说的嵌入式是指消费类电子等产品的技术内置于一些微处理器芯片中,在日常应用中,可以是单片机,但目前,随着ARM芯片的大规模生产,**进一步减少,所以越来越多的企业应用ARM芯片,ARM芯片可以裸机运行,也就是 操作系统不安装为单片机,但其处理速度和内存远远超过单片机。但是带有操作系统的 CPU 可以看作是一台微型计算机,它的作用与我们的计算机相同。 所谓嵌入式开发,是指基于ARM的一系列芯片的研发,如硬件电路的构建、底层驱动程序的编写、应用软件的编写等。

    开发环境平台很多,比如Microsoft的Wince,Linux只是其中之一,因为Linux操作系统是开源的或者不收取专利费,内核占用的空间也比较小,所以大多数厂商都是在Linux操作系统的基础上开发新产品。

    当操作系统安装在ARM芯片上时,可以在其上编写应用软件。

    它可以用 C C++ 开发,Linux 内核是用 C 编写的,所以应用程序是在 Linu 下用 C 编写的。 因此,有必要学习Linux嵌入式开发的第一学号C语言。 在Linux操作环境中,Qt应用程序类似于C++,可以更改人脸对象的语言以创建人机界面。

  2. 匿名用户2024-01-27

    ARM 是 Advance RISC Machines 的缩写,RISC(Reduced Instrument Set Computer)是一组简化指令。

    嵌入式系统。

    一般指非PC系统,具有计算机功能但不称为计算机的设备或设备。 它以应用为中心,软硬件可以减少,适应应用系统对功能、可靠性、成本、体积、功耗等全面而严格的要求。

    简单来说,嵌入式系统集成了系统的应用软硬件,类似于BIOS在PC中的工作方式,具有软件小、自动化程度高、响应速度快等特点,特别适合需要实时和多任务处理的系统。 嵌入式系统主要由嵌入式处理器、相关配套硬件和嵌入式操作系统组成。

    和应用软件系统,这是一个可以独立工作的“设备”。

    嵌入式系统几乎包括生活中所有的电气设备,如PDA、移动计算设备、电视机顶盒、手机上网、数字电视、多**、汽车、微波炉、数码相机、家庭自动化系统、电梯、空调、安防系统、自动售货机等。

    蜂窝**、消费电子设备、工业自动化仪器和医疗仪器等

  3. 匿名用户2024-01-26

    ARM是一种结构,有特定的芯片,嵌入式是一个通用术语,因为有更多的软件编程用于嵌入式开发! 可以用 C C++ 和 ARM 组装! 实际上,我学习了一段时间,然后转行了! 呵呵。

  4. 匿名用户2024-01-25

    嵌入式开发包括软硬件开发,硬件开发中使用的主流芯片是ARM芯片; Linux是一个操作系统,它的开发是一些底层驱动和应用软件的开发,可以用C C++进行开发。

  5. 匿名用户2024-01-24

    嵌入式包括 ARM,而 ARM 只是一个结构和方向。

  6. 匿名用户2024-01-23

    Linux 是操作系统内核。 ARM嵌入式,正在谈论硬件。 也就是说,作为开发的一部分,由基于 ARM 的 CPU 制成的机器的开发嵌入到设备上。 方法如下:

    1. 新建一个目录:mkdir embedded linux,并将 linux 内核解压到这个目录:tar -jxf -c embedded linux。

    2. 配置内核有三种方式:做配置文本配置; make menuconfig 菜单配置方法; make xconfig GUI 配置方法(需要安装 qt)。

    3. 进入终端命令:make menuconfig 打开内核配置界面。

    4、内核根据项目需要进行修剪,System V IPC(IPC:Inter Process Communication)是一个群组系统调用和函数库,是程序运行所必需的,其余的根据个人需要收录或删除。

    5. 配置完所有必需的选项后,按 esc 退出,选择是保存,即可完成。

  7. 匿名用户2024-01-22

    Linux是操作系统,软件ARM是硬件! 嵌入式就是将软件植入硬件,实现智能化! 所以两者之一是必不可少的! 我想当我刚开始学习嵌入西方嵌入时,我什么都不懂,呵呵!

  8. 匿名用户2024-01-21

    Linux测试平台,ARM测试一个核心,没有直接关系,不管是否适用于ARM核心,也可以嵌入。

  9. 匿名用户2024-01-20

    1.它属于嵌入式开发。

    开发分为裸奔和基本虚拟租赁到操作系统。

    3.按操作系统分为移植开发、带动向东开发和操作系统上层纯宇博应用软件开发。

  10. 匿名用户2024-01-19

    1 嵌入式系统概述。

    应该肯定地说,我们每个人都使用过嵌入式系统相关产品,嵌入式系统已经渗透到我们生活的每一个角落。 他从事过我们想象力所能达到的广泛领域。 嵌入式系统是相对于桌面系统而言的,所有带有微处理器的专用软件和硬件系统都可以称为嵌入式系统。

    微处理器作为系统的核心,包括三大类:微控制器(MCU)、数字信号处理器(DSP)和嵌入式微处理器(MPU)。 嵌入式比定义更准确,如下所示:

    系统以应用为中心,以计算机技术为基础,软硬件可量身定制,适应应用系统对功能、可靠性、成本、体积和功耗的严格要求。

    嵌入式系统的应用和组件。

    嵌入式系统是流线型的计算机系统,现在 arm7 处理器比 486 更快,可以挂很多设备,而且非常低。 嵌入式技术的目的是在不适合计算机使用的情况下替换PC系统,在很多场合,工业计算机的许多功能都毫无用处,用户必须付出代价,嵌入式系统解决了这个问题,兼顾功能,节省成本,切掉不需要的设备。 嵌入式系统无处不在,其核心是处理器。

    包括单片机也是一种嵌入式处理器,不同级别的处理器在实际应用中的应用方向也不同。

  11. 匿名用户2024-01-18

    ARM是一家芯片设计公司,与Intel和AMD类似,由于嵌入式系统CPU的能耗要求很高,ARM在嵌入式领域的份额明显高于Intel和AMD的PC CPU,也就是所谓的X86系统CPU。 这就是为什么人们在谈论嵌入式时会想到 ARM 芯片的原因。 ARM只做设计,而真正的芯片是由三星和德州电气等公司生产的,ARM只收取费用。

    Linux是操作系统内核,单个Linux内核在一定程度上不能称为操作系统,当Linux与GNU结合时,操作系统就完整了。 现在,Linux 内核由 Linux** 协会开发。 Linux之所以与嵌入式和ARM密切相关,是因为Linux是开放的,这样会有很多可用的资源,因为嵌入式系统与PC不同,很多硬件是可以改变的,在这种情况下,开放Linux提供了极大的便利。

    另外,Linux本身也是一个优秀的开发环境,它的开始是天才程序员和黑客的功劳,因为它与UNIX兼容,所以大量的高级程序员都在它下面工作,这与Windows不同,Windows更像是一个娱乐系统,用Windows开发真的很郁闷。 比如Windows的API有上千个系统调用,而且更新速度很快,程序员都得跟着走,别无他法,但是当他们学习后再淘汰,所以Windows程序员很辛苦,但是Linux或者类Unix的系统调用只有100个左右,你的技术够难熟练用的, 你可以把大部分精力集中在做实际工作上,所以Linux是一个完美的开发环境。

    正因为如此,当ARM开始单独嵌入的时候,Linux就成了开发者的标准开发环境,现在嵌入式开发太多了,Microsoft没有支持ARM系统的操作系统,所以Microsoft先天就缺乏嵌入式。

  12. 匿名用户2024-01-17

    嵌入式Linux是一个操作系统,ARM是一个使用ARM指令集的处理芯片。

    通俗地说,就是用电脑做一个比较。 如果 ARM 相对于 Intel 处理器(当然,它也可以与 AMD 处理器进行比较),那么嵌入式 Linux 对应于 Windows XP 系统。

    所以可以简单地说,嵌入式Linux是操作系统,ARM是CPU

相关回答
5个回答2024-05-02

从区域来看,做底层驱动比较流行,应用层做比较多。 一般来说,该地区的处理是10k-20k

6个回答2024-05-02

做嵌入式开发,我认为软硬件都懂得,这是嵌入式大师应该追求的,也是大师们唯一的出路。 >>>More

12个回答2024-05-02

简单:

ARM7 在保护模式下不需要 MMU 单元,在功能上用作实时控制系统。 >>>More

16个回答2024-05-02

嵌入式软件工程师的月薪在10000元以上。

移动通信行业是嵌入式软件最重要的应用领域之一,手机嵌入式软件几乎占整个嵌入式软件应用规模的60%。 在3G时代,手机、数字电视、信息家电、网络、汽车电子、医疗电子等将是嵌入式软件的重要应用领域。 >>>More

5个回答2024-05-02

如果想向嵌入式软件方向发展,最常见的就是嵌入式linux的方向,我认为这个方向大概有3个阶段: >>>More